Space spiderweb alert! 🕷 Here’s a creepy celestial NASAHubble photo of a dying star called CW Leonis - just in time for Halloween! The orange-red "cobwebs" in this image are actually dusty clouds of carbon engulfing a star at the end of its life. At a distance of 400 light-years from Earth, CW Leonis is the closest carbon star to our home planet. CW Leonis has a relatively low surface temperature of 2,300 degrees Fahrenheit. The greenish beams of light emanating from the star are enhanced for better analysis through infrared image color-contrast.
